Joan Kennedy dies – She was the wife of Senator Ted Kennedy

Kennedy struggled for many years with alcoholism and depression, and became one of the first women in the United States to speak publicly about her struggle with addiction

Newsroom October 8 06:01

Joan Kennedy, the first wife of Massachusetts Senator Ted Kennedy, has passed away at the age of 89.

She died peacefully in her sleep at home, as confirmed by a family spokesperson. Joan Kennedy was married to the late senator for 24 years. The couple had three children: Kara, Ted Jr., and Patrick.

Kennedy struggled for many years with alcoholism and depression, and became one of the first women in the United States to speak publicly about her battle with addiction.

Joan Bennett Kennedy was a model and pianist when she married Ted Kennedy in 1958.
